Character Modeling Character Anatomy and Proportions 2 — Questions and Answers
Question 1: What anatomical feature makes the clavicle important to model accurately in character creation?
- It controls leg deformation
- It drives shoulder and arm movement silhouette (Correct answer)
- It determines facial proportions
- It anchors the hip geometry
Correct answer: It drives shoulder and arm movement silhouette
The clavicle connects the sternum to the scapula and greatly influences the shoulder silhouette and believability of arm movement.
Question 2: In anatomy-based character modeling, what is the purpose of understanding muscle origins and insertions?
- To set shader values
- To place edge loops for realistic deformation (Correct answer)
- To calculate UV seams
- To determine texture resolution
Correct answer: To place edge loops for realistic deformation
Knowing where muscles originate and insert helps place edge loops along muscle groups, enabling realistic deformation during animation.
Question 3: Which muscle group creates the visible V-shape from shoulder to waist on a well-built male character?
- Deltoids
- Latissimus dorsi (Correct answer)
- Trapezius
- Pectorals
Correct answer: Latissimus dorsi
The latissimus dorsi muscles flare out from the lower back to the armpits, creating the characteristic V-taper silhouette of an athletic male torso.
Question 4: Why is the skull shape important when modeling a character's head geometry?
- It defines texture coordinates
- It provides the underlying form that facial features sit upon (Correct answer)
- It controls shader complexity
- It determines polygon count limits
Correct answer: It provides the underlying form that facial features sit upon
The skull is the underlying structural form that determines head shape, brow prominence, cheekbone placement, and overall facial topology.
Question 5: What is the significance of the 'landmarks' technique in character modeling anatomy?
- It defines UV island boundaries
- It identifies key bony protrusions that guide surface form (Correct answer)
- It sets rendering quality levels
- It manages polygon density
Correct answer: It identifies key bony protrusions that guide surface form
Landmarks are bony protrusions visible through skin that guide the placement of surface details and ensure anatomically plausible form.
Question 6: In character modeling, what does 'foreshortening' awareness help a modeler achieve?
- Correct proportions when a limb is viewed at an angle (Correct answer)
- Faster rendering times
- Cleaner UV unwraps
- Reduced polycount on extremities
Correct answer: Correct proportions when a limb is viewed at an angle
Understanding foreshortening ensures that limbs and body parts read correctly from any camera angle, not just straight-on orthographic views.
